Surf with Friends with FriendFeed

Never have lulls in conversation again. FriendFeed lets you keep up with everything your friends or family are viewing or listening to online. Sign up for an account, invite your friends and you'll see the latest YouTube video they marked as a favorite, the music they have been listening to lately and the latest story they Dugg.



It works like an RSS feed - when content is shared, the feed takes notice and publishes that material to the shared feed. So, if a YouTube video is marked as a favorite by one of your friends, you'll see a thumbnail of the video on your feed. You can view the feeds in any feed reader, as a Facebook application or even embed into your own blog or website. A nice variety of sites are supported by FriendFeed including del.icio.us, Digg, Flickr, LinkedIn, Netflix, Pandora, Twitter, Yelp and more.
